Discover the Heart of Cameroon: A 7-Day Journey Through Douala and Yaoundé
Cameroon, often referred to as "Africa in Miniature," offers a rich tapestry of landscapes, cultures, and experiences. Douala, the economic hub, is a vibrant city known for its bustling port and lively markets. Meanwhile, Yaoundé, the political capital, is nestled among lush hills and offers a more laid-back atmosphere with its museums and cultural sites.
Douala's history as a trading post is evident in its diverse architecture and cultural influences. The city is a melting pot of traditions, with a lively arts scene and a reputation for its delicious street food. Yaoundé, on the other hand, is known for its green spaces and cultural institutions, making it a perfect destination for those looking to explore Cameroon's heritage.

Day 5: Discovering Yaoundé
Morning: Visit the National Museum of Yaoundé to learn about Cameroon's rich history and culture. The museum is housed in a former presidential palace and offers fascinating exhibits.
Afternoon: Explore the Mvog-Betsi Zoo, home to a variety of native wildlife, including primates and big cats. It's a great spot for families and animal lovers.

Day 6: Yaoundé's Cultural Gems
Morning: Start your day with a visit to the Benedictine Monastery of Mont Febe, offering stunning views of the city and a peaceful atmosphere.
Afternoon: Head to the bustling Mokolo Market, where you can shop for local crafts, textiles, and fresh produce. It's a great place to experience the local culture and pick up souvenirs.
